Now's your chance to put a little back if you've ridden at Gisburn over the last year. We've got a big dig day planned this Sunday to try and do some repair work on the Hully Gully / Rollercoaster section. Be really good to have a decent turn out this weekend as we've got a lot of gravel to shift. If you can lend a hand PM me you email and I'll send you some details / maps etc.

If you're riding at Gisburn on Sunday be aware the Gulley will be shut.

If you aren't close to Gisburn get out and join a dig day near you.
